Seniors relish NCAA title
Posted Apr 7, 2009
Tyler Hansbrough, Danny Green and Bobby Frasor were entrusted as stewards of the UNC program back in 2005, baby-faced freshmen coming to a school that had just won its fourth NCAA championship. With Monday night’s 89-72 dismissal of Michigan State in the NCAA championship game, the Tar Heels’ three seniors, who played such a critical role both this season and the last four years, can say they left the program in even better shape than they found it.
